I came across these at work where we use them to install aircraft windshields, which are HEAVY and awkward to get into position. These cups will be great working on sliding glass doors to lift out and repair rollers and tracks. Pump the piston until it is completely retracted, and you're locked on solid. If it starts leaking down, you'll see the piston working its way up, giving you plenty of warning before it lets go. A push button lever on the opposite side releases the piston when you're ready. The only drawback I see is that the handle is plastic. Feels strong enough but it is plastic. If it were aluminum or steel this thing would be nearly indestructible.
